Lets see the recipe of Mango kalakand.
Ingredients
1 & 1/2 cup Fresh chenna
1/2 cup condensed milk
1/2 cup Mango pulp (use fresh for best result)
3 tbsp milk
3 no. cardamom powder (crushed)
few chopped pistachios/ saffron for garnishing
Take it out and cut into squares
Preparation
Mash the chenna coarsely and keep aside.In a thick bottom pan take mango pulp and cook for 1 – 2 minutes by stirring continuously
Add condensed milk, milk powder to the mango pulp, once they mix well add crumbled chenna and cardamom powder
Keep stirring in low medium heat for at least 8-10 minutes till the mixture becomes thick and leaving sides of the pan
Remove from heat and spread this mixture onto a greased tin / plate
Sprinkle pistachios and saffron on top and cool it Keep it in refrigerator for 1-2 hour
Enjoy eating
Note; Chenna can be prepared by using vinegar,lemon juice or citric acid. Wash the chenna thoroughly so the smell of vinegar, lemon etc goes away.
